
Aquatic Therapy is designed to benefit children by working on therapeutic skills in a gravity assisted environment. The pool setting offers a variety of water-based activities that enhance or restore mobility and function in a warm water environment.

Our therapists will find fun and creative ways to improve your child’s gross motor skills and improve their ability to perform functional daily activities.

Daily life “occupations”, AKA activities, for children include everything from playing, dressing, feeding, and bathing to handwriting and social interactions. Occupational therapists help to improve a child’s performance and participation in all of those activities.

Teletherapy is therapy via a live video connection. The treatment session is similar to an in-person session, however it is over a computer (or other device) instead!

Communication skills are an essential aspect of a child’s overall development, health, learning experiences, self-esteem, and ability to express their basic wants and needs. These skills are also incredibly important to school performance and social interaction.

Medical Support Services is “IN-NETWORK” with most insurance providers including the following:
Medicaid (Forward Health), Anthem Blue Cross Blue Shield, United Healthcare, Humana, Aetna, Asha, UMR, Health EOS/MultiPlan, Network Health, WEA, Trilogy, Molina, Children’s Community Health Plan, Together with CCHP, Managed Health, Community Care/Family Care, and community based programs such as the children’s long term waiver and IRIS.
At Medical Support Services, we want therapy to be as affordable as possible for our families. We are “in network” with most providers, offer affordable payment plans, and have a billing staff to help answer any questions you may have about alternative funding sources.
